The gap between protein structure prediction and function prediction keeps getting wider. We can predict a fold at near-experimental resolution, but ask the same model whether that protein binds a specific metabolite or catalyzes a reaction, and it's basically guessing. The whole "structure determines function" mantra is breaking down as we realize that many proteins are conformational ensembles, not static locks waiting for a key.
